I'm seeing this too on my PowerMac 9500, even with 2.6.18-rc7 from <http://kernel-archive.buildserver.net/debian-kernel/>.
The kernel somehow loses the information where the initrd image is placed in memory. The correct data is there in arch/powerpc/kernel/prom_init.c:prom_check_initrd(), but in init/initramfs.c:populate_rootfs() it's wrong, initrd_{start,end} are both 0. So this definitely looks like a kernel problem. I'll continue to investigate. Cheers, Christian Aichinger PS: Please CC me, I'm not subscribed to d-kernel.
